The poem is about growing old and lamenting what happens to the body as one ages. "Now" refers to the older person, "then" to that person when they were younger.

Q: What does now and then mean in the poem Ah For the change 'twixt now and then?

What does loveliest of trees the cherry now mean?

"Loveliest of Trees, the Cherry Now" is a poem by A. E. Housman that reflects on the beauty and brevity of life. The speaker in the poem contemplates the fleeting nature of cherry blossoms and how they serve as a reminder to appreciate the beauty of life while we can.

What does a1 mean on a gun?

Indicates a model change from the original. The original might be a Model 1911. When it has a design change, it is now a Model 1911A1.
